[Back]

Calculator
〜Javaで電卓〜


■ プレビュー

Javaで電卓


■ ソース

<SCRIPT LANGUAGE="JavaScript">
<!--
function calc(ch) {
   if (ch == "=") {
      document.form1.text1.value =
          eval(document.form1.text1.value);
      }
   else if (ch == "C") {
      document.form1.text1.value = "";
      }
   else {
      document.form1.text1.value += ch;
   }
}
// -->
</SCRIPT>

■ 使い方

  1. 上のプログラムを、文章を表示したいhtmlファイルの間にコピーして下さい。
  2. 電卓を表示したい部分に、次のように記述して下さい。

  <FORM NAME="form1" ACTION="">
    <CENTER>
    <B><FONT SIZE=4>Javaで電卓</B></FONT><P>
    <INPUT TYPE="text" NAME="text1" VALUE="" SIZE=26>
    <P>
    <INPUT TYPE="button" VALUE=" 7 " onClick="calc('7')">
    <INPUT TYPE="button" VALUE=" 8 " onClick="calc('8')">
    <INPUT TYPE="button" VALUE=" 9 " onClick="calc('9')">
    <INPUT TYPE="button" VALUE=" * " onClick="calc('*')">
    <P>
    <INPUT TYPE="button" VALUE=" 4 " onClick="calc('4')">
    <INPUT TYPE="button" VALUE=" 5 " onClick="calc('5')">
    <INPUT TYPE="button" VALUE=" 6 " onClick="calc('6')">
    <INPUT TYPE="button" VALUE=" / " onClick="calc('/')">
    <P>
    <INPUT TYPE="button" VALUE=" 1 " onClick="calc('1')">
    <INPUT TYPE="button" VALUE=" 2 " onClick="calc('2')">
    <INPUT TYPE="button" VALUE=" 3 " onClick="calc('3')">
    <INPUT TYPE="button" VALUE=" - " onClick="calc('-')">
    <P>
    <INPUT TYPE="button" VALUE=" 0 " onClick="calc('0')">
    <INPUT TYPE="button" VALUE=" C " onClick="calc('C')">
    <INPUT TYPE="button" VALUE=" = " onClick="calc('=')">
    <INPUT TYPE="button" VALUE=" + " onClick="calc('+')">
    </CENTER>
  </FORM>